Design of An Agent-Based Simulation Model of Service Supply Chain

Abstract:
The present research aimed to design an agent-based simulation model of the service supply chain. In this respect, library studies were first conducted, and then the research gap was found. Suppliers were divided into suppliers of fast-moving consumer goods and slow-moving consumer goods, repairmen, and medicine suppliers, while services were divided into general, emergency, specialized, and nursing services, and patients were divided into people with insurance and those without insurance. Also, conditions of the service supply chain in this hospital were investigated and analyzed from different aspects. Next, this supply chain was implemented using NetLogo software, and the amount of unfulfilled demand and other cases were checked, and various weaknesses and gaps were shown. In the following, it was tried to decrease the existing gaps by developing different scenarios. Although the results of all the scenarios showed improved conditions, apparently, fast-moving consumer goods are the least affected by the decreased demand gap compared to the developed scenarios. In the maintenance section, the cost of preventive and in fact its increase can have the greatest effect. Regarding the increase of people covered by health insurance, the increase of insured people is a better scenario than reducing the treatment costs, and in fact, the reduction in treatment costs increase the number of people covered by health care services as it should.
